I´ve just received my first batch of models for my Dailami project, and I must say that Old Glory15s Dailami are just superb! Five (or six) different posses, with swords and spears. Also, to add some variety I ordered to bags of Seljuk Dailami (the first ones were from Arab Conquest range). They had three posses, and looked good, too, but, men, the arab conquest range is a-m-a-z-i-n-g.
